Hints and tips on viewing house or flat on sharing basis
Accommodation costs are one of your main expenses of university. It is worth spending the extra time to help make sure you'll have a hassle free year. Make sure the house is in a convenient location for pubs, shops and transport links to the campus. Walk the route back from the bus stop at night and make sure you feel comfortable. When you're at the actual property make a thorough check of the condition it is in:
Exterior - does the roof look sound and water tight? (look for signs of damp on the ceiling when you go inside), are the gutters and drains clear?, is there any woodwork rotting and unsafe?, is the garden tidy and trouble free? (you'll be responsible for its upkeep), are the external doors and locks secure?, are the windows clean? (you'll be responsible for keeping them clean)
Interior - has the house got enough furniture (in a decent condition) for the occupants?, is there sufficient space in the kitchen to store and prepare food?, is the fridge/freezer big enough?, do the electrical appliances all work?, is the heating system adequate?, do the taps/toilet/shower all work and not leak?
Safety - is there a copy of the CORGI gas safety certifcate? (a legal requirement), has the electrical wiring been checked in the last 3 years?, does the property have working smoke and carbon monoxide alarms?
